Subdomains are good in Yahoo
I set up two sites on the same topic with similar, but not duplicate content. On one site, I used directories to divide the topics. On the other, I used subdomains. The same set of KWs were used to name directories and subdomains.
The site with directories has numerous IBLs (marketleap 789) due to actively seeking links. Each page in the directories has about 90 internal IBLs. The subdomain site has few IBLs (marketleap 62) on the www. and almost all of these are from the subdomains. The subdomains have about 4 IBLs each all from the www. I gave the subdomain site a couple of links from a third site just to get it spidered, but otherwise did not build links.
The pages in the directories are mostly PR2. The subdomains are PR0 or 1.
In Yahoo, both sites rank about the same (5 to 12) for a KW phrase that includes the directory or subdomain name. The SERPs show the directory or subdomain page optimized for that KW, not the site index that has all the IBLs.
Yahoo is giving ranking the subdomain site very well considering almost no IBLs. It's nowhere in G and M. Either Yahoo doesn't give a yodel about IBLs or it gives a subdomain a boost.
